Which gas is often called ‘Laughing Gas’?
ACarbon Dioxide
BOxygen
CMethane
DNitrous Oxide
Explanation
• Nitrous Oxide ($N_2O$) is used in dentistry and surgery as an anesthetic.
• Its nickname comes from the euphoric effect it produces when inhaled.
• It is also used as a propellant in whipped cream dispensers.
